WHITE EMPLOYEES ARE STANDING UP AGAINST DISCRIMINATION IN THE LA & CALIFORNIA WORKPLACE
In California, it is against the law for an employer to discriminate against an employee because of his or her race or color. When we think of racial discrimination, we usually think of blacks and Asians and Hispanics being targeted for the color of their skin. However, more white men and women --- weary of a generation of minority racial preferences and concerned about job security in this feeble economy --- are joining minorities in crying foul and standing up against adverse treatment in the workplace based primarily on the color of their skin.
An employer can discriminate against you, the black, white, Hispanic, or Asian, employee, in many ways. Examples include not hiring you, firing you, demoting you, not promoting you, and / or not providing you with equal benefits as your co-workers.
